Our Addison, Ill plant is looking for a Lead Process Technician to lead our 2nd or 3rd shift. This professional develops, tests, and manages the manufacturing of permanently rigid, heat-resistant plastics. They will oversee polymer processing, quality control, and shop floor operations. They direct production, troubleshoot resin batch or molding issues, maintain ERP data and train staff while ensuring safety compliance.
Nature of Duties:
Setup molds in injection and compression molding presses. Maintain press uptime during shifts by keeping machines full of material. Troubleshoot press parameters to produce parts within specification. Ensure all employees on shift are performing duties up to job expectations. Maintain operation conditions within set tolerances. Recommend improvements in production methods, equipment, operating procedures and working conditions. Set up and monitor molding machines, adjust barrel/mold temperatures and ensure proper curing Resolve batch defects, flow marks, or premature curing issues on the production floor. Proper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) and adherence to safety guidelines. Maintain 5S at the workstation and all areas of the plant. Maintain and evaluate operator training. Maintain training records and production skills matrix. Other duties as assigned.
Education and Experience:
High School diploma or GED 5+ years of plastics processing experience in injection molding Ability to communicate in English and Spanish (written/orally).
